Conversant

usgb/kənˈvɜːrsnt/
adjective

Familiar with something, or having experience in it.

She is conversant with the issues faced by the LGBTQ+ community.

LampPro Tip 1/3

Topic Familiarity

Use 'conversant' to show depth of knowledge on specific topics or skills.

As a programmer, he's conversant in several coding languages.
LampPro Tip 2/3

Active Interaction

Implies active engagement or participation in discussions about a topic.

She remained conversant in policy debates throughout her career.
LampPro Tip 3/3

Beyond Basics

'Conversant' suggests more than basic understanding but not necessarily expert-level.

I'm conversant with the basics of photography, but still learning.
